The Challenge with Sage 50’s Default Printing

Like many accounting platforms, Sage 50’s native check printing module is not optimized for blank stock. It lacks the essential features required for creating a full, bank-compliant check from scratch, such as:

  • MICR Font Creation: It cannot generate the special E-13B MICR font required for automated bank processing.
  • Flexible Layout Control: It doesn’t have the sophisticated layout tools needed to precisely place all the check elements (payee, amount, MICR line, signature) onto a blank page.
  • Bank Account Flexibility: Managing multiple bank accounts often requires complex and cumbersome setup within the Sage 50 environment.

The Solution: A Universal Virtual Printer

The most effective way to print from Sage 50 onto blank stock is to use a universal check printing software that functions as a virtual printer. An application like MultiCHAX is designed to work with virtually any Windows-based accounting program, including Sage 50.

Here’s how this workflow overcomes Sage 50’s limitations:

1. It Captures Print Data: When you print a check run from Sage 50, you select the MultiCHAX virtual printer instead of your physical office printer. The software intercepts the data—payee, amount, address, etc.—that Sage 50 sends.
2. It Applies a Secure Template: The MultiCHAX software then merges this captured data with a pre-configured, secure check template. This template contains all the static information, such as your company details, bank logo, and the critical MICR line data for your bank account.
3. It Prints a Complete Check: The software sends the final, complete check image to your laser printer (loaded with a MICR toner cartridge) to be printed on blank check stock.

Step-by-Step Guide for Sage 50 Users

Step 1: Install and Configure Your Check Printing Software

First, install an application like MultiCHAX on your computer. The initial setup involves creating a check template for each of your bank accounts. You will enter your bank routing number, account number, and company information. You can also add a digital signature file for automated signing, which you should password-protect for security.

Step 2: Set the Printer in Sage 50

Open Sage 50 and navigate to the printer setup for checks. This is typically found under `Reports & Forms > Forms > Checks`. In the printer settings for your check form, select the MultiCHAX virtual printer as the designated printer.

Step 3: Run Your Check Payments as Usual

There is no need to change your accounts payable process within Sage 50. You will continue to select bills for payment and enter payments as you normally do. When you are ready to print, simply execute the print command.

Step 4: Print from Sage 50

When you initiate the print job, Sage 50 will send it to the MultiCHAX virtual printer. The software will automatically apply the correct template, format the MICR line, and print a perfect, bank-compliant check to your laser printer.
